Well I'm sat here in a small corner of our house, surrounded by workmen whizzing around filling boxes. The laptop's about the only thing that hasn't been packed now. Poor Charlie doesn't have a clue what's going on. He looked very worried when he saw his cot being dismantled!

Everything seems to be going pretty well though in our last week. Finished work a week ago, to a great (but emotional) farewell party. Spent a very busy week sorting out boxes and things to chuck from the house. Also managed to fall out of the attic on Friday, but no bones broken! Packers here today & tomorrow, fingers crossed we exchange on our house on Wednesday, car is being sold on Thursday then we fly on Friday!

Packing stuff for the plane has been a nightmare. We're taking two 30Kg suitcases, 4 carry-on bags, travel cot, buggy & car seat. And I still only have about 4 changes of clothes (including 1 jumper, 1 jacket & 1 pair of shoes)...to last 3 months...in winter...though Dubai is 40 degrees... We shall either smell or be going shopping pretty quickly!

We've managed to use all of our air miles to upgrade to business class for the flight, so I'm hoping the upgrade is worth it to make the journey as stress free as possible!

We're taking a week to get to Dunedin with a couple of stopovers in Dubai & Sydney (24hrs straight on a plane with a 1 yr old would have been too traumatic!) then a few weeks travelling before we arrive in Wellington.

I can't believe it's all happening now. So terrifying and exciting all at the same time!

Looking forward to meeting some of you on the other side of the planet soon!
